ISIS Moves Operations To W’Africa, US Warns

The United States has identified Nigeria and the Lake Chad Basin as critical fronts in its 2026 counterterrorism strategy, warning that extremist groups operating across Africa remain a growing threat to global security.

In the strategy document, the US government said parts of Africa, including West Africa, the Sahel region, the Lake Chad Basin, Mozambique, Sudan and Somalia, have witnessed a resurgence of terrorist activities following the collapse of ISIS strongholds in Iraq and Syria.

The document noted that remnants of the Islamic State and affiliated jihadist groups had relocated to Africa and Central Asia, exploiting ungoverned spaces and weak security structures.

“Subsequently, the surviving remnants of the world’s most dangerous terrorist group of the modern age were forced to relocate to Africa and Central Asia, in turn exploiting the ungoverned spaces there.

The US said its major objective in Africa would be to prevent extremist groups from establishing operational bases capable of launching attacks against American interests.
